diff options
Diffstat (limited to '')
| -rw-r--r-- | modules/git/default.nix |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/modules/git/default.nix b/modules/git/default.nix index a0b2573..465d859 100644 --- a/modules/git/default.nix +++ b/modules/git/default.nix @@ -21,9 +21,6 @@ </script> ''}"; - cache-root = "/var/cache/cgit"; - cache-size = 50; - enable-follow-links = true; enable-commit-graph = true; enable-git-config = true; @@ -56,10 +53,14 @@ }; "vapor-systems" = { - inherit settings; enable = true; scanPath = "/var/lib/git"; + settings = settings // { + cache-root = "/var/cache/cgit"; + cache-size = 50; + }; + nginx.virtualHost = "git.vapor.systems"; }; }; @@ -83,6 +84,7 @@ isSystemUser = true; group = "git"; home = "/var/lib/git"; + homeMode = "755"; createHome = true; shell = "${pkgs.git}/bin/git-shell"; openssh.authorizedKeys.keys = lib.flatten ( |
